Author Rickford, John R., 1949-

Title Spoken soul : the story of Black English / John Russell Rickford and Russell John Rickford ; foreword by Geneva Smitherman.

Publication Info. New York : Wiley, [2000]
©2000

Description xii, 267 pages, 8 unnumbered pages of plates : illustrations ; 24 cm
Bibliography Includes bibliographical references (pages 231-258) and index.
Contents What's going on? -- "This passion, this skill, this incredible music": Writers -- Preachers and pray-ers -- Comedians and actors -- Singers, toasters, and rappers -- Living language: vocabulary and pronunciation -- Grammar -- History -- Ebonics firestorm: education -- Media -- Ebonics "humor" -- Double self: the crucible of identity
